Hi! I'm Ben, a professional classical guitarist and music educator with over 15 years of teaching experience.
I've toured across the U.S., Europe, and China, and since 2014 I've performed extensively with the acclaimed Minneapolis Guitar Quartet. My specialty is classical guitar, but I've spent years playing and teaching across styles including jazz, rock, blues, folk, and fingerstyle. That range helps me meet students wherever their interests are while making sure they're building solid technique from the start.
I also perform in a guitar duo with my wife, Milena Petković, and have recorded CDs, led workshops and masterclasses, and collaborated with ensembles like The Mirandola Ensemble. Music has been my whole life, and I bring that experience into every lesson.

A Bit About Me
I hold a Master of Music in classical guitar performance from the Cleveland Institute of Music. I've been teaching students of all ages and levels for over 15 years, and performing has been a constant throughout, from solo recitals to touring with the Minneapolis Guitar Quartet.
